I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Signal Discussion :

Filtrage son wav..


Sujet :

Signal

  1. #1
    Candidat au Club
    Inscrit en
    Janvier 2008
    Messages
    3
    Détails du profil
    Informations forums :
    Inscription : Janvier 2008
    Messages : 3
    Points : 2
    Points
    2
    Par défaut Filtrage son wav..
    bonjour suite a un projet .. j'aurais aimé savoir comment l'on procéde pour filtrer un son wav sur matlab a l'aide d'un filtre passe-bas puis comment faire de la modulation avec le son filtré ?? merci d'avance..

  2. #2
    Rédacteur

    Homme Profil pro
    Comme retraité, des masses
    Inscrit en
    Avril 2007
    Messages
    2 978
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 83
    Localisation : Suisse

    Informations professionnelles :
    Activité : Comme retraité, des masses
    Secteur : Industrie

    Informations forums :
    Inscription : Avril 2007
    Messages : 2 978
    Points : 5 179
    Points
    5 179
    Par défaut
    Salut !

    Pour ce qui est du filtrage, il y a plusieurs solutions, mais celle que je préconiserais serait d'imaginer un filtre analogique, d'écrire ses équations différentielles, d'imposer les valeurs stockées dans ton .wav et d'intégrer par Runge-Kutta. Ce n'est pas une méthode traditionnelle en traitement de signal, mais c'est fiable.

    En ce qui concerne la modulation, il en existe de nombreuses sortes (d'amplitude, de fréquence, etc.) et il est indispensable de savoir laquelle tu veux appliquer, car les algorithmes sont très différents.

    Jean-Marc Blanc
    Calcul numérique de processus industriels
    Formation, conseil, développement

    Point n'est besoin d'espérer pour entreprendre, ni de réussir pour persévérer. (Guillaume le Taiseux)

  3. #3
    Candidat au Club
    Inscrit en
    Janvier 2008
    Messages
    3
    Détails du profil
    Informations forums :
    Inscription : Janvier 2008
    Messages : 3
    Points : 2
    Points
    2
    Par défaut toujours le mm probleme...
    j'aurais aimé savoir le code pour généré un filtre passe-bas a appliqué a un son wav. il faut utilisé la fonction sptool apparamen mais je n'y arrive pas...

  4. #4
    Rédacteur

    Homme Profil pro
    Comme retraité, des masses
    Inscrit en
    Avril 2007
    Messages
    2 978
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 83
    Localisation : Suisse

    Informations professionnelles :
    Activité : Comme retraité, des masses
    Secteur : Industrie

    Informations forums :
    Inscription : Avril 2007
    Messages : 2 978
    Points : 5 179
    Points
    5 179
    Par défaut
    Salut !

    filtrer un son wav sur matlab a l'aide d'un filtre passe-bas
    A lire ta première question, je croyais naïvement que tu savais ce qu'était un filtre passe-bas, comment c'était réalisé et comment ça fonctionnait. Si ce n'est pas le cas, tu trouveras tous les renseignements nécessaires sur Wikipedia.org .

    Ensuite, quand tu connaitras les équations qui régissent le fonctionnement de ton filtre, tu pourras les intégrer avec la fonction ode45.

    Jean-Marc Blanc
    Calcul numérique de processus industriels
    Formation, conseil, développement

    Point n'est besoin d'espérer pour entreprendre, ni de réussir pour persévérer. (Guillaume le Taiseux)

  5. #5
    Candidat au Club
    Inscrit en
    Janvier 2008
    Messages
    3
    Détails du profil
    Informations forums :
    Inscription : Janvier 2008
    Messages : 3
    Points : 2
    Points
    2
    Par défaut encore moi...
    je sais ce qu'est un filtre passe-bas.. mais je n'arrive pas a utilisé la fonction sptool afin de généré mon filtre sur mon wav...saurais tu comment faire ?

  6. #6
    Rédacteur/Modérateur

    Avatar de Jerome Briot
    Homme Profil pro
    Freelance mécatronique - Conseil, conception et formation
    Inscrit en
    Novembre 2006
    Messages
    20 302
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ations professionnelles :
    Activité : Freelance mécatronique - Conseil, conception et formation

    Informations forums :
    Inscription : Novembre 2006
    Messages : 20 302
    Points : 52 880
    Points
    52 880
    Par défaut
    SPTOOL est un outil assez vaste... as-tu pris le temps de bien lire la documentation qui s'y rapporte ?

    => SPTool: A Signal Processing GUI Suite
    Ingénieur indépendant en mécatronique - Conseil, conception et formation
    • Conception mécanique (Autodesk Fusion 360)
    • Impression 3D (Ultimaker)
    • Développement informatique (Python, MATLAB, C)
    • Programmation de microcontrôleur (Microchip PIC, ESP32, Raspberry Pi, Arduino…)

    « J'étais le meilleur ami que le vieux Jim avait au monde. Il fallait choisir. J'ai réfléchi un moment, puis je me suis dit : "Tant pis ! J'irai en enfer" » (Saint Huck)

  7. #7
    Membre régulier
    Profil pro
    Inscrit en
    Novembre 2007
    Messages
    90
    Détails du profil
    Informations personnelles :
    Âge : 40
    Localisation : France

    Informations forums :
    Inscription : Novembre 2007
    Messages : 90
    Points : 74
    Points
    74
    Par défaut
    Salut,

    filtrer un son wav sur matlab a l'aide d'un filtre passe-bas
    Une première refléxion de mart en lisant ceci, est de penser à faire un filtrage fréquentiel passe bas.
    Donc pourquoi chercher l'équation d'un filtre alors que tu peux passer ton signal au domaine fréquentiel (avec une FFT trame par trame) ensuite appliquer ton filtre au spectre (simple fenêtrage) et revenir dans le domaine temporel (avec une FFT inverse) ???

    A moins que cette méthode n'est pas utilisée dans le traitement de signal ???

Discussions similaires

  1. Filtrage d'un son wav
    Par patricx dans le forum Signal
    Réponses: 3
    Dernier message: 09/12/2011, 12h45
  2. API Sound - Filtrage passe-bas d'un son Wav
    Par Anified dans le forum Multimédia
    Réponses: 0
    Dernier message: 09/03/2010, 01h06
  3. Créer un champ contenant un son wav dans une base Paradox
    Par Grandad95 dans le forum Bases de données
    Réponses: 4
    Dernier message: 21/07/2004, 17h00
  4. Existe t'il un composant permettant de jouer un son wav?
    Par scorpiwolf dans le forum C++Builder
    Réponses: 5
    Dernier message: 20/06/2002, 14h10

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o